Which consumer goods companies in Missouri sponsor TN visas?
Missouri's consumer goods employers with a documented history of TN visa filings include Anheuser-Busch InBev and Budweiser's St. Louis operations, Cargill's Missouri processing facilities, Energizer Holdings, and Nestlé Purina PetCare. Larger manufacturers with established HR and legal infrastructure are generally better positioned to navigate TN sponsorship than smaller regional producers, though sponsorship is never guaranteed and depends on the specific role and candidate qualifications.
Which cities in Missouri have the most consumer goods TN sponsorship jobs?
St. Louis is Missouri's primary hub for consumer goods TN jobs, anchored by Anheuser-Busch InBev, Energizer, and Nestlé Purina's corporate and manufacturing operations. Kansas City is a strong secondary market, particularly in food processing, agricultural products, and distribution, with employers like Cargill and Hallmark. Smaller industrial cities including Joplin and Springfield also host manufacturing facilities with occasional professional openings.
What types of consumer goods roles typically qualify for TN sponsorship in Missouri?
Roles that commonly qualify under the TN visa in Missouri's consumer goods sector include industrial engineers, chemical engineers, food scientists, mechanical engineers, computer systems analysts supporting supply chain or ERP platforms, and management consultants engaged for defined projects. The position must fall within an approved TN occupation category and require at least a bachelor's degree in a directly related field. General management, sales, and operations roles without a specific degree requirement typically do not qualify.

Are there any Missouri-specific or industry-specific considerations for TN sponsorship in consumer goods?
Missouri does not impose state-level work authorization requirements beyond federal rules, so TN sponsorship follows standard federal procedures. Within consumer goods specifically, food and beverage manufacturing roles often require candidates to demonstrate that their degree is directly tied to a USMCA-listed occupation, which can be a closer call for hybrid roles in quality assurance or production management. Working with an immigration attorney familiar with Missouri-based employers is advisable when the degree-to-role alignment is not straightforward.
